Hyphema appears as a bright or dark red fluid level between the cornea and iris or as a diffuse murkiness of the aqueous humor. The blood tends to gravitate inferiorly and can usually be detected as a fluid level using a pen torch light. The dark red or black color of an 8-ball hyphema the most dangerous type is associated with decreased circulation of aqueous humor and decreased oxygen in the anterior chamber of the eye.
